TL;DR

  • Amnesty International warns of an "acute human rights crisis" surrounding the 2026 FIFA World Cup in the US, Mexico, and Canada.
  • The organization cited concerns over "paramilitary-style" immigration raids, mass detentions, and deportations in the United States.
  • Freedom of expression is reportedly under pressure in all three host nations, with documented cases of journalist persecution and protest repression.
  • Mexico is described as the most dangerous country for the press in the Western Hemisphere, and a crisis of disappeared persons persists.
  • Concerns are raised about the safety of LGBTQI+ individuals, with some fans opting not to display visible support due to perceived discriminatory policies.
  • Amnesty International urges FIFA, governments, and host cities to uphold freedom of expression, halt deportations during the tournament, and combat discrimination.
